summ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Sky Leite <sky@leite.dev>2023-02-04 00:14:28 -0300
committerSky Leite <sky@leite.dev>2023-02-04 00:21:31 -0300
commite3e1cf2df730f2dc12882e1f33b2a7ba44647de9 (patch)
tree60beb62062bfd81cb1ea55728d97b8e2b9e9a5a7
parent93587fe33bdeefb7368a347ad60f9baf601b8eaa (diff)
downloaddecky-loader-e3e1cf2df730f2dc12882e1f33b2a7ba44647de9.tar.gz
decky-loader-e3e1cf2df730f2dc12882e1f33b2a7ba44647de9.zip
Fix F811 linter rule
get_user_group was defined twice, so I merged both definitions
-rw-r--r--backend/helpers.py12
1 files changed, 5 insertions, 7 deletions
diff --git a/backend/helpers.py b/backend/helpers.py
index 0c1ba6b1..e2385506 100644
--- a/backend/helpers.py
+++ b/backend/helpers.py
@@ -96,11 +96,6 @@ def get_user_owner(file_path) -> str:
return pwd.getpwuid(os.stat(file_path).st_uid).pw_name
-# Get the user group of the given file path.
-def get_user_group(file_path) -> str:
- return grp.getgrgid(os.stat(file_path).st_gid).gr_name
-
-
# Deprecated
def set_user_group() -> str:
return get_user_group()
@@ -112,8 +107,11 @@ def get_user_group_id() -> int:
# Get the group of the user hosting the plugin loader
-def get_user_group() -> str:
- return grp.getgrgid(get_user_group_id()).gr_name
+def get_user_group(file_path) -> str:
+ if file_path:
+ return grp.getgrgid(os.stat(file_path).st_gid).gr_name
+ else:
+ return grp.getgrgid(get_user_group_id()).gr_name
# Get the default home path unless a user is specified